THIS CONSIDERABLE OVERVIEW WORKS AS YOUR KEY TO UNLOCKING THE SECRETS OF INTERNET SOLUTIONS AND ENDING UP BEING A MASTER IN THE FIELD

This Considerable Overview Works As Your Key To Unlocking The Secrets Of Internet Solutions And Ending Up Being A Master In The Field

This Considerable Overview Works As Your Key To Unlocking The Secrets Of Internet Solutions And Ending Up Being A Master In The Field

Blog Article

Written By-Schou North

Discover the utmost Web Solutions Handbook for all your demands. Explore interaction procedures, core concepts of SOAP and REST, and ideal techniques for seamless application. Discover the secrets to mastering internet solutions, from understanding the essentials to carrying out scalable style. Master the art of making safe and secure systems and enhancing for future growth. Unlock the power of web solutions at your fingertips.

Review of Web Solutions



If you have actually ever before wondered what web services are and just how they work, this review is the excellent area to begin. Internet services are a method for different applications to connect with each other online. They permit seamless integration of systems, making it much easier to share information and capabilities.

Among the essential elements of web services is their use of conventional methods like HTTP and XML to help with interaction. This standardization makes sure that different systems can recognize and interact with each other properly. Web services can be categorized right into two major types: SOAP (Simple Object Access Protocol) and REST (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while REST relies upon basic HTTP methods like obtain, PUBLISH, PUT, and erase. Both have their strengths and are used in numerous situations based upon needs.

Key Ideas and Technologies



Discovering the foundational concepts and technologies of internet services is crucial for understanding their capability and application in contemporary systems. When delving into the essential concepts and innovations of internet services, you open the door to a world of interconnected possibilities. Below are some essential elements to understand:

- ** SOAP (Simple Object Access Method) **: This method specifies the framework of messages traded in between web solutions.
- ** WSDL (Web Services Description Language) **: WSDL is utilized to define the performances offered by an internet solution.
- ** REST (Representational State Transfer) **: An architectural design that uses basic HTTP methods for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in information exchange between web services due to its adaptability and readability.

Understanding these core concepts and technologies will lay a strong foundation for your trip right into the realm of internet services.

Best Practices for Execution



To make certain effective implementation of internet solutions, prioritize adherence to finest techniques. Begin by extensively documenting your internet service APIs, including clear summaries of endpoints, specifications, and anticipated actions. Regular calling conventions and versioning of APIs are important for maintainability. When designing your web services, adhere to the principles of REST to create a scalable and versatile architecture. Apply correct verification and permission systems to protect your services, such as OAuth or API keys.

Testing is vital in ensuring the dependability of your internet services. Develop extensive test cases that cover numerous circumstances, including favorable and unfavorable screening. Continual assimilation and automated screening can help capture issues early in the growth process. Screen your internet services in real-time to determine efficiency traffic jams and potential failures. Logging and mistake handling are vital for detecting problems and repairing problems efficiently.


Last but not least, consider the scalability of your web services deliberately for future growth. mobile website design caching devices and lots harmonizing to deal with increased website traffic. Regularly review and maximize your code for effectiveness. By following these ideal practices, you can streamline the implementation of web solutions and ensure their success.

Final thought

Congratulations! You have actually just unlocked the trick to mastering internet solutions. By comprehending visit their website and modern technologies, and implementing best methods, you're well on your method to coming to be an internet solutions specialist.

Maintain exploring and try out what you've learned to proceed increasing your expertise and abilities in this exciting area.

The globe of web services is now at your fingertips, ready for you to check out and overcome. Take pleasure in the journey!